]> git.ipfire.org Git - thirdparty/knot-resolver.git/commitdiff
modules/renumber: remove useless code
authorTomas Krizek <tomas.krizek@nic.cz>
Tue, 23 Nov 2021 10:24:01 +0000 (11:24 +0100)
committerTomas Krizek <tomas.krizek@nic.cz>
Wed, 24 Nov 2021 13:56:04 +0000 (14:56 +0100)
Unspecified mask is already returned as full bitlen by
kr_straddr_subnet().

modules/renumber/renumber.lua

index 25e8624fe3fb345a1e70646557d1bbf4649d7aeb..425bc0546428f04f71f347bce87a91556157633f 100644 (file)
@@ -10,10 +10,6 @@ local function matchprefix(subnet, addr)
        local addrtype = string.find(addr, ':', 1, true) and kres.type.AAAA or kres.type.A
        local subnet_cd = ffi.new('char[16]')
        local bitlen = ffi.C.kr_straddr_subnet(subnet_cd, subnet)
-       -- Mask unspecified, renumber whole IP
-       if bitlen == 0 then
-               bitlen = #target * 8
-       end
        return {subnet_cd, bitlen, target, addrtype}
 end